The course covers a wide variety of legal topics, broken into four units. The units are assessed in the ways outlined above. The unit and topics included in this course are: Dispute Solving in Civil Law (including civil dispute resolution; enforcement of civil law; how judicial precedent works; and the application of the law of negligence). This is an externally assessed unit. Investigating Aspects of Criminal Law and the Legal System (including exploring how statutory rules are made and interpreted; how legislation is made outside of Parliament; legal personnel involved in a criminal trial; and key elements of crime and sentencing for non-fatal offenses). This is an internally assessed unit. Applying the Law (including the law relating to homicide; the laws relating to corporate manslaughter; offences against property; general defences in criminal law; and police powers). This is an externally assessed unit. Aspects of Family Law (including the formation of marriage, civil partnerships, and cohabitation; methods for dissolving a relationship; the distribution of money and property; and resolving disputes over children). This is an internally assessed unit. All topics are taught in an applied way, to develop students’ capacities to offer legal advice and guidance in ways that echo the professional practice of Solicitors and other legal personnel. The course is partly designed by professional bodies aiming to develop requisite professional skills and knowledge for students interested in careers in Law.
